Disney Plus vs Apple TV Plus: Battle of the “Netflix killers”
The battle for your streaming video subscription dollars will be getting a lot more crowded in November. That’s when the two biggest new services in this growing industry are scheduled to go live. Disney Plus (launching November 12) and Apple TV Plus (launching November 1) will both offer what looks like some excellent original content, […]
Disney Plus vs Apple TV Plus: Battle of the “Netflix killers” Read More »